Very sad news, Cogenhoe has been one of the best run and friendliest Clubs in the UCL for 4 decades and somewhere I’ve enjoyed many a visit to, from watching you know who in the Northant’s youth league and early Diamonds days to just popping down the 428 and getting a Tuesday night football match. A highlight certainly being watching their under 18’s loose very narrowly to QPR in the FA Youth Cup a very proud day for all involved. The work done there by one Mr D Wright and his team over the years was immense but regardless how busy they were on match days there was always time to extend a welcome and have a chat. Hopefully they will be back some time soon.
